ABSTRACT

OBJECTIVE: Major depressive disorder is a debilitating and recurrent psychiatric disorder. Blueberries have several biological properties, including neuroprotective effects, through antioxidant and anti-inflammatory actions. The aim of this study was to evaluate the effect of blueberry extract on depressive-like behavior and lipopolysaccharide (LPS)-induced neurochemical changes. METHODS: Mice were pretreated with vehicle, fluoxetine (20 mg/kg) or blueberry extract (100 or 200 mg/kg) intragastrically for seven days before intraperitoneal LPS (0.83 mg/kg) injection. Twenty-four hours after LPS administration, mice were submitted to behavioral tests. Oxidative stress and neuroinflammatory parameters were evaluated in the cerebral cortex, hippocampus, and striatum. RESULTS: Our data showed that blueberry extract or fluoxetine treatment protected against LPS-induced depressive-like behavior in tail suspension and splash tests (P < 0.05), without changes in locomotor activity (P > 0.05). LPS induced an increase in the levels of reactive oxygen species (P < 0.001), nitrite (P < 0.05) and thiobarbituric acid reactive substances (P < 0.01), as well as a reduction in total sulfhydryl content (P < 0.05) and catalase activity (P < 0.05) in brain structures; blueberry extract restored these alterations (P < 0.05). In addition, blueberry extract attenuated the increase in tumor necrosis factor-alpha (TNF-α) levels induced by LPS administration (P < 0.05). CONCLUSION: This study showed that blueberry extract exerted antidepressant-like effects, protected the brain against oxidative damage, and modulated TNF-α levels induced by LPS.

ABSTRACT

ABSTRACT: The present study aimed to evaluate the use of aqueous wheat extracts as an adjunct to antineoplastic therapy with carboplatin. In this study, 32 rats were used which were randomly distributed into 4 groups: G1 - negative control; G2 - control treated with physiological solution; G3 - animals treated with aqueous extract of wheat in the concentration of 100mg/kg; G4 - animals treated with aqueous wheat extract at the concentration of 400mg/kg; 300mg/m² of carboplatin was administered intraperitoneally at day 0 in animals from groups G2, G3, and G4, whereas 1ml of physiological solution was administered by the same route in animals from group G1. Animals were treated daily for 21 days by orogastric gavage according to their respective experimental group. Blood was collected from animals on days 3, 7 and 21 for complete blood count (CBC), biochemistry, and measurement of paraoxonase 1 (PON1) activity. On day 21, animals were euthanized and necropsied. Promising results were obtained regarding oxidative balance in groups G3 and G4. Both presented better PON1 activity in comparison with group G2 (P<0.05). Total leukocyte count of group G4 differed significantly from group G2 (P<0.05) on day 21. Myelogram values of animals from groups G3 and G4 were ​​similar to those from G1; animals from G3 had lower numbers of promyelocytes and increased numbers of erythrocytes and rubriblasts than animals from G2 (P<0.05). In the present experimental study, aqueous wheat extract was safe at the doses used in the animals, and was an effective treatment for myelosuppression and for the prevention of an excessive release of free radicals induced by carboplatin.

ABSTRACT

This study assessed the pH, radiopacity, antimicrobial effect, cytotoxicity and biocompatibility of endodontic filling materials for primary teeth. Zinc oxide eugenol (ZOE), Vitapex and Calen paste thickened with zinc oxide (ZO) were evaluated in comparison to an experimental MTA-based material. Radiopacity was tested using a graduated aluminum stepwedge with a digital sensor (n=5). The materials pH was recorded at 1, 4, 12 h; 1, 3, 7, 15 and 30 days (n=5). Direct contact test was used to assess the antimicrobial efficacy against Enterococcus faecalis after 1, 4, 12, 24 h (n=5). Cytotoxicity assay used MTT test for cell viability after incubation for 1, 3 and 7 days (n=5). For biocompatibility test, Wistar rats had received implants containing each material (n=5). The biopsied tissues were histologically analyzed after 15, 30 and 60 days. The results of radiopacity, pH, antimicrobial capacity and cytotoxicity were analyzed using ANOVA and Tukey tests. The histological data were submitted to Kruskal-Wallis test. The experimental material presented the lowest radiopacity (3.28 mm Al) and had a pH>12.0 throughout the test period. The experimental material showed the highest antibacterial effect, killing over 99.97% bacteria in 4 h. Vitapex presented the highest cell viability. Initially, biocompatibility test showed moderate to severe inflammation in all groups. After 60 days, Calen+ZO group showed moderate inflammation, while the others showed predominantly mild inflammatory reaction. The present results demonstrated that the experimental MTA-based material exhibited satisfactory behavior regarding the studied properties. Additional in vivo studies are necessary for a better evaluation of the material.

ABSTRACT

Background: Squamous cell carcinoma (SCC) is a malignant cutaneous neoplasm which occurs frequently in small animals. Histopathology or fine needle aspiration cytology is necessary to confirm diagnosis; macroscopic diagnosis is not possible since the lesions are very similar to others of distinct etiologies. Owing to the fact that it is a neoplasm, diagnosis and treatment are usually not well accepted by owners, especially since it can cause esthetic changes to the animal and adjunct treatments can cause unwanted side effects. The objective of this study was to report clinical cases of SCC with distinct tumor subtypes and relate the recommended treatment with prognosis of patients. Case: Two dogs and one cat with SCC that were subjected to physical and dermatological examination, and tested negative for sporotrichosis, cryptococcosis, and manges. Dog 1 (male, 9-year-old, yellow Labrador retriever) exhibited inspiratory dyspnea for three weeks owing to an ulcerative hemorrhagic lesion on the nose. In view of the site of the lesion, a radiographic exam was requested, and the bony portion of the septum was found to be compromised. Cat 2 (female, 10-year-old, bicolor, mixed-breed cat) exhibited a focal, punctate, ulcerated, hemorrhagic lesion on the nose. Dog 3 (female, 10-year-old, white Dogo Argentino) exhibited several ulcerative lesions, and papulae, plaques and comedones on the ventral region of the abdomen.Treatment for deep pyoderma and comedone syndrome were initially instituted; on follow-up, more ulcerative lesions were present, which prompted the inclusion of neoplasm as a differential diagnosis. In cases 1 and 3, histopathology was performed with diagnosis of undifferentiated and differentiated SCC, respectively. This study aimed to evaluate and compare the process and quality of healing of surgical wounds in dogs treated with chlorhexidine 0.5 % (CHX), polyvinylpyrrolidone-iodine (PVP) 10% and 0.9% saline solution (NaCI). Thirty surgical ovariosalpingohisterectomy wounds from healthy female dogs were clinically studied. These animals were divided into groups according to PVPI, CHX and NaCI treatments. Regarding the results achieved there was no statistical difference at the end of the healing process. In the assessment of scar quality, the presence of harmonics scars on NaCI and CHX groups was observed. It is possible to conclude thus that the healing process of surgical wounds in dogs treated with 0.5 % chlorhexidine and polyvinylpyrrolidone-iodine (PVP) 10% is similar, although the wounds treated with 0.5 % chlorhexidine are harmonic whereas those treated with PVP do not present this aspect.

ABSTRACT

Diets can be formulated in many different ways in order to assess metabolic ailments, however, animal welfare must be considered when preparing homemade chow, according with the chosen animal model. This assay analyses the composition of a modified AIN-93 diet for mice, and its effect on weight gain and blood glucose levels on Swiss/WB mice. Initially, normal and hyperlipidic chow were prepared and subjected to bromatology assays. Ten Swiss/WB mice were fed with either commercial chow, or one of the two lab-made preparations for 60 days. After this period, weight and blood glucose levels were assessed weekly for another 60 days. The animals that were fed commercial chow had lower weight and glucose levels, compared to the lab-made chow. The hiperlipidic and normal chow fed mice did not differ in these parameters. The bromatology revealed that the normal chow, formulated accordingto the recommendations of AIN-93M had a high amount of carbohydrates, and low amounts of proteins, under the recommended levels for the species. Thusly, this study shows that a diet considered normal may be altering the metabolic functions of mice, probably due to an altered carbohydrate to protein ratio.

External otitis is a frequent affection in small animal’s clinic. In dogs this illness has variable clinic presentation which demands different therapies. The objective of this study was evaluated the effect of flushing external auditory conduit with sterile saline solution in purulent ears with external otitis. 36 ears with purulent otitis of dogs were studied, through inspection of acoustic shells, otoscopy, bacterial culture and antibiogram. The ears were divided in groups A (18) and B (18). In the group A was realized only one ear flushing in the day “0” and in both groups the ears were treated with topi solution and systemic anti-bacterial 12 in 12 hours. In the final of 15 days of treatment was demonstrated statistic difference (p=0,023) between the groups for quantity of exudates in otoscopy. In the same period was observed statistic differences in group A for itch(p=0,0009), otalgia (p=0,001 and erythema (p=0,001), while in group B just for erythema (p=0,004). Gram+ and Gram- bactéria was isolated, that decreased in both groups. The bacteria were more sensitive to gentamicin. The ear flushing of external ear of dogs with instillation and aspiration of saline solution contributed to external otitis treatment, reducing itch, otalgia, eythema and exudates
